Fp8 pytorch
WebOrdinarily, “automatic mixed precision training” with datatype of torch.float16 uses torch.autocast and torch.cuda.amp.GradScaler together, as shown in the CUDA … WebMontgomery County, Kansas. / 37.200°N 95.733°W / 37.200; -95.733. / 37.200°N 95.733°W / 37.200; -95.733. Montgomery County (county code MG) is a county …
Fp8 pytorch
Did you know?
WebMay 14, 2024 · FP16 has a limited range of ~ +/-65k, so you should either use the automatic mixed-precision util. via torch.cuda.amp (which will use FP16 where it’s considered to be save and FP32 where needed) or you would have to transform the data and parameters to FP32 for numerically sensitive operations manually in case you want to stick to a manual ...
WebOct 9, 2024 · To support this empirical research, we introduce QPyTorch, a low-precision arithmetic simulation framework. Built natively in PyTorch, QPyTorch provides a convenient interface that minimizes the efforts needed to reliably convert existing codes to study low-precision training. QPyTorch is general, and supports a variety of combinations … WebMay 17, 2024 · To my knowledge, PyTorch’s mixed precision support (Automatic Mixed Precision package - torch.cuda.amp — PyTorch 1.8.1 documentation) does not handle …
WebThe Fairchild F8 is an 8-bit microprocessor system from Fairchild Semiconductor, announced in 1974 and shipped in 1975. The original processor family included four … WebJul 5, 2024 · As a strong supporter of industry standards, AMD is advocating for the adoption as the new standard for 8-bit floating point notation with IEEE.”. John Kehrli, Senior Director of Product Management at Qualcomm Technologies, Inc. said: “This proposal has emerged as a compelling format for 8-bit floating point compute, offering significant ...
WebToday a PR opened to Pytorch to formally introduce the FP8 data type. Current text: Proposal of fp8 dtype introduction to PyTorch PR…
WebDevised a new FP8 floating point format that, in combination with DNN training insights, allows GEMM computations for Deep Learning to work without loss in model accuracy. Developed a new technique called chunk-based computations that when applied hier-archically allows all matrix and convolution operations to be computed using only 8-bit dove baby soap phWebMar 22, 2024 · Transformer Engine uses per-layer statistical analysis to determine the optimal precision (FP16 or FP8) for each layer of a model, achieving the best … dove baby moisturizing lotionWebTo ensure that PyTorch was installed correctly, we can verify the installation by running sample PyTorch code. Here we will construct a randomly initialized tensor. From the command line, type: python. then enter the following code: import torch x = torch.rand(5, 3) print(x) The output should be something similar to: dove baby shampoo tescoWebWhether it's raining, snowing, sleeting, or hailing, our live precipitation map can help you prepare and stay dry. dove baby sensitive and fragrance freeWebFP8 autocasting. Not every operation is safe to be performed using FP8. All of the modules provided by Transformer Engine library were designed to provide maximum performance … dove baby lotion expiration dateWebJun 24, 2024 · run prepare () to prepare converting pretrained fp32 model to int8 model. run fp32model.forward () to calibrate fp32 model by operating the fp32 model for a sufficient number of times. However, this calibration phase is a kind of `blackbox’ process so I cannot notice that the calibration is actually done. run convert () to finally convert the ... civil procedure rules solomon islandsWebTensors and Dynamic neural networks in Python with strong GPU acceleration - pytorch/.flake8 at master · pytorch/pytorch civil procedure rules small claims track